Deploy step 4 — ChronoGate reader firmware

Flash the Fenwick Marathon timing-chip readers from the staging bucket only. Verify checksum before push; readers brick on partial writes. Batch ten units, confirm heartbeat, then proceed. Do not flash during an active race window — Ilka owns the schedule. Rollback image stays on the SD slot. All firmware bundles must be signed before the readers will accept them, using this deploy key:

release key, yagap-kagag: bky6_1ks93y

Handover Note — Q3 Stock-Count Ledger

Dev, I've finished reconciling the quarterly stock-count ledger for the Ashgrove warehouse; all variances are initialled on pages 14–16. The ledger is in the locked drawer of the shift office, key on the usual hook. A courier from Pellman Runners collects it Tuesday at 09:00 — original only, no photocopies travel. Please pass the courier the following hand-over instruction:

handover note for yagef-bagep: the drudor pelius courier leaves the kasdor zorvan norir ledger at gate 8016 under passcode 755406

Subject: Quickstore 4.2 — bloom filter now fronts the KV layer

Plugin authors: starting with this release, Quickstore places a bloom filter ahead of the key-value store. Negative lookups return faster; false positives fall through safely. No API changes are required on your side. Verify your plugin against the staging build referenced below.

session token of fahif-tadup = htk3_9c7

**Q: Are the lifts running this weekend?** No. Both lifts in the Halloway Annexe are down for winch maintenance Saturday 06:00 to Sunday 18:00. Direct staff to the east stairwell. Goods deliveries should be deferred or rerouted via the Penfold loading dock. Contractors from Bray Vertical Systems will be on site; they sign in at the facilities desk as normal. The stairwell door locks after 19:00, so anyone working late will need the weekend access code. Issue it only to rostered staff. The code is below.

badge for bawef-bahap: bdg-LALUM-4